多线程使用指南

当使用pthread、openmp等多线程程序,一般使用的是单个节点,多个核并行计算。
假设多线程的程序为program,则一般提交的任务的语法为:
交互式
srun -c 8 program [args]脚本提交
multi.sbatch

#!/bin/bash
#SBATCH -c 8
program [args]
使用sbatch multi.sbatch进行提交。

其中-c 指定需要的核数,或者说是运算的线程数量。由于单节点的核数为16,该数量不要超过16。